With a playoff win on the line, DuBois Central Catholic rose to the challenge on Saturday. They took down the Otto-Eldred Terrors 46-29. The win was familiar territory for the Cardinals, who have now won seven matches in a row.
Otto-Eldred's defeat shouldn't obscure the performances of Carrie Drummond, who posted ten points, and Rayel Hakes, who put up six points and seven rebounds.
DuBois Central Catholic's victory bumped their record up to 24-2. As for Otto-Eldred, their loss dropped their record down to 22-5.
The two teams are set to take part in some playoff action in their next matches. DuBois Central Catholic will face off against Bishop Canevin at 1:00 p.m. on Saturday. As for Otto-Eldred, they will square off against Geibel Catholic on Saturday.
